The decentralized finance (DeFi) ecosystem has revolutionized traditional finance by providing decentralized, borderless, and permissionless solutions. These platforms allow individuals to lend, borrow, stake, and trade without intermediaries, offering transparency and efficiency. Central to the success of any DeFi project is a meticulously developed white paper—a comprehensive document that communicates the project’s vision, technical framework, governance, tokenomics, and roadmap to investors, users, and the broader community. White Paper Development is more than presenting information; it establishes credibility, inspires confidence, and serves as a strategic blueprint for long-term growth in a competitive DeFi environment.

Tokenomics and Incentive Structures

Tokenomics is the foundation of a DeFi project’s economic system. A white paper must clearly describe token allocation, utility, and incentives, as well as mechanisms for governance, staking, and rewards. Well-structured tokenomics ensures user engagement and project sustainability. This section should explain how tokens circulate, how stakeholders benefit, and how inflation or misuse is prevented. By presenting a balanced economic model, the project demonstrates foresight and financial prudence. A comprehensive tokenomics section assures investors and users that the platform has a stable and rewarding ecosystem capable of sustaining growth and adoption over time.

  • Token Distribution and Utility
    Clearly explain token allocation across stakeholders and its role within the ecosystem. A transparent token model builds trust with investors and users.

  • Staking and Reward Mechanisms
    Highlight ways users can earn rewards, stake tokens, or participate in governance. Strong incentives encourage platform adoption and active participation.

  • Sustainable Economic Design
    Demonstrate that the tokenomics model is balanced, preventing inflation or unsustainable practices. Long-term sustainability ensures continued engagement and investor confidence.

Security, Reliability, and Compliance

Security, reliability, and compliance are critical to DeFi success. A white paper must detail measures taken to ensure smart contract integrity, prevent vulnerabilities, and maintain operational stability. Investors and users need assurance that the platform is secure and dependable. Regulatory compliance enhances credibility and reduces legal risks while maintaining transparency. By emphasizing cybersecurity protocols, system reliability, and adherence to regulations, the project demonstrates professionalism, foresight, and commitment to protecting stakeholders. This section reassures readers that the platform is both trustworthy and prepared for sustainable, long-term adoption.

  • Smart Contract Audits and Cybersecurity
    Highlight the importance of third-party audits, penetration testing, and vulnerability assessments. Security reassures investors and protects platform users.

  • Operational Reliability
    Discuss measures to ensure consistent performance, system uptime, and resilience against failures. Reliability is crucial for user trust and adoption.

  • Regulatory Compliance
    Ensure the project aligns with local and global regulations. Compliance practices enhance credibility and reduce legal risks while maintaining transparency.
